What does an associate pricing manager do?

An Associate Pricing Manager is responsible for assisting in the development, implementation, and analysis of pricing strategies for a company's products or services. This role involves working closely with sales, marketing, and finance teams to evaluate market trends, competitor pricing, and customer demand to optimize profitability. Typical tasks include conducting pricing analysis, preparing reports, supporting price setting, and ensuring pricing compliance. Associate Pricing Managers often help identify opportunities to improve margins while maintaining competitiveness in the market.

How does an associate pricing manager typically collaborate with sales and marketing teams to inform pricing strategies?

As an Associate Pricing Manager, you will regularly work with sales and marketing teams to gather market intelligence, understand customer needs, and assess competitive positioning. This collaboration helps ensure that pricing strategies are aligned with overall business goals and market realities. You may participate in cross-functional meetings, provide analytical support, and help develop pricing proposals that maximize profitability while remaining competitive. Effective communication and the ability to interpret data for non-technical stakeholders are key aspects of this collaborative process.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as an associate pricing manager, and why are they important?

To thrive as an Associate Pricing Manager, you need strong analytical skills, a solid understanding of pricing strategies, and a degree in business, finance, or a related field. Familiarity with pricing software, advanced Excel functions, and ERP systems, as well as experience with data visualization tools, is typically required. Excellent communication, attention to detail, and collaborative problem-solving abilities are crucial soft skills in this role. These competencies enable you to set competitive prices, drive profitability, and respond effectively to market changes.

What is the difference between Associate Pricing Manager vs Pricing Analyst?

AspectAssociate Pricing ManagerPricing Analyst
Required CredentialsBachelor's degree in Business, Finance, or related field; some roles prefer certifications like CPC or CPMBachelor's degree in Finance, Economics, or related field; certifications like CPC or CPM are common
Work EnvironmentCollaborative teams within pricing, marketing, and sales departments; often involved in strategic planningData-driven roles focused on analyzing pricing data, market trends, and supporting pricing strategies
Employer & Industry UsageUsed in retail, manufacturing, and logistics companies to develop and implement pricing strategiesCommon in finance, consulting, and retail sectors for analyzing and recommending pricing adjustments

The Associate Pricing Manager and Pricing Analyst roles share similar educational backgrounds and certifications, often working within the same industries. However, the Associate Pricing Manager typically has a broader strategic focus and collaborates more closely with management, while the Pricing Analyst concentrates on data analysis and supporting tactical pricing decisions.

How much does an Associate Pricing Manager earn?

An Associate Pricing Manager typically earns between $60,000 and $85,000 annually, depending on experience, industry, and location. Entry-level positions may start lower, while those with specialized skills or certifications can earn higher salaries. Compensation often includes bonuses and benefits related to pricing analysis and strategy tools.

What degree do you need to be an Associate Pricing Manager?

An Associate Pricing Manager typically requires a bachelor's degree in fields such as business, finance, economics, or a related discipline. Relevant skills include data analysis, proficiency with pricing tools, and understanding market trends; some roles may prefer or require advanced degrees or certifications in pricing or analytics.

What You Can Expect

The Manager leads a high-performing pricing organization, drives best-in-class pricing processes, and serves as a strategic advisor to senior commercial, finance, and operations leaders. This role exercises significant independent judgment, influences executive decision-making, and ensures alignment between pricing strategy, market dynamics, and corporate objectives.

How You'll Create Impact
  • Engage with senior-level customer, distributor, and GPO stakeholders as needed to support strategic negotiations and relationships
  • Define and monitor KPIs that measure pricing effectiveness, deal quality, margin realization, and commercial value creation.
  • Oversee the end-to-end pricing and contracting lifecycle, ensuring efficiency, scalability, and compliant execution through defined operating models.
  • Lead, mentor, and develop pricing analysts, fostering a culture of accountability, continuous improvement, and strategic thinking.
  • Serve as a strategic thought partner to senior commercial, finance, legal, and operations leaders on complex pricing and contracting decisions.
  • Own enterprise pricing and contracting for GPOs, IDNs, strategic and local customers aligned to corporate growth and margin objectives.
  • Set clear performance expectations, success metrics, and development plans for team members.
  • Provide training which will enable the field organization and pricing group team members to optimize price & sales potential.
  • Prepare slides for Price Committee and maintain product line technical expertise.

This is not an exhaustive list of duties or functions and might not necessarily comprise all of the essential functions for purposes of the Americans with Disabilities Act

What Makes You Stand Out
  • Enterprise leadership mindset with ability to set priorities.
  • Demonstrated success leading geographically dispersed teams.
  • Strong financial and business acumen with ability to evaluate trade-offs and long-term value.
  • Advanced understanding of GPO, IDN, and complex healthcare contracting models.
  • Ability to influence executive stakeholders without direct authority.
  • Exceptional communication and presentation skills.
  • Proven ability to translate analytics into strategic insights and decisions.
  • Highly motivated, self-starter willing to meet strict deadlines and time constraints.
  • Advanced proficiency in pricing, analytics, and ERP tools (e.g., SAP, Vendavo, Alteryx, Tableau).
  • Attention to detail and ability to work with large amounts of data.
Your Background
  • Bachelor's Degree and 4 years of relevant experience, or Associate's Degree and 6 years of relevant experience, or High School Diploma or Equivalent and 8 years of relevant experience is required
  • Bachelor's Degree in business or related field and 8+ years of related experience is preferred.
  • Advanced Microsoft Office Suite required.
  • Pivot Tables and VLOOKUP query experience required SAP, Vendavo, Alteryx, and Tableau experience preferred.
  • Management experience required
Travel Expectations
  • Up to 25%
